On Monday, 1 June 2015 16:31:26 UTC+3, Stefan Monnier wrote: > > I'm working on building a HTPC with Mixtile LOFT-Q(A31 - > > https://github.com/mixtile/loftq-docs) and for completeness I wanted to > > Have you tried the SATA port? Is it connected to the A31 via USB? > What kind of transfer speeds do you get (both reading, and writing)? > How 'bout support for SMART or setting things like the spindown timeout?
Yes, the guy designing those confirmed he's using a USB-SATA adapter and the board itself also has a 12V source for powering the HDD. I have not tested it yet, but I'll report back when I do. I don't suppose you'll get more than 25-30MB/s which I get now using the USB external hard-drive. No idea about SMART though, I've had mixed experiences with USB-to-SATA and smartctl.
